## Digest Scheduler Onboarding

The Quillpost batch digest scheduler runs hourly and groups pending notifications per tenant. Schedules live in the `digest_windows` table; never edit them mid-run. If the scheduler's encrypted state store must be rebuilt after a crash, unlock it with the recovery passphrase that follows.

recovery phrase for fawif-tajeg: norael-aldmir-casir-brivan-ulaion

Ticket: Intermittent connection failures during Bramleaf stale-cache postmortem verification. While replaying last Tuesday's incident, the cache-invalidation job failed to reconnect after the primary failover, which is how stale entries survived the flush. We need this reproduced before the weekly eng sync so the timeline section of the postmortem is accurate. Steps: run the replay harness against the snapshot, watch for reconnect storms in the job logs, and record invalidation lag. The snapshot database is reachable via the string below.

replica DSN, kajep-yahag: mssql://praok_svc:iF@db-8d68.plorvaio.local:5432/eliion

**Q2 Planning Note — For the Incoming Director**

Welcome aboard. The big item on your desk is the term sheet from Quillbrook Partners. It's generous on co-marketing but their exclusivity ask in the Ashfell region is a sticking point — Dario pushed back twice and they haven't budged. Legal wants a decision before month-end so we don't lose the favourable royalty tier. Read the confidential note below before your first call with them.

internal memo for yahag-hahig: Belwynix Group plans to lower the Silir list price by 62 percent in May.